Inspiring Mathematicians 4: Pythagoras

Pythagoras was an ancient Greek mathematician and philosopher who lived around 570–495 BCE and is widely regarded as one of the founders of mathematical thought in the Western world.

Born on the island of Samos, he later established a philosophical and mathematical school in Croton in southern Italy, where numbers and geometry were studied as the foundation of reality and harmony.

He is most famous for the Pythagorean Theorem, which describes the relationship between the sides of a right triangle.

Beyond mathematics, Pythagoras and his followers explored music, astronomy, ethics, and philosophy, believing that numerical relationships governed the universe.

His ideas deeply influenced later Greek mathematics, philosophy, and scientific reasoning.
